Output e24609fd54cf89db2780dbc0ab8fe65f1800d6c239aba22e1925e0339e8afeb5:87

value
190531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 809b1da1998076fa8d45aacd63d71a124c7d7e2b OP_EQUAL
address
3DR2EjEwT7smMSXCMFLnFJudXdk7SxeyYZ
transaction
e24609fd54cf89db2780dbc0ab8fe65f1800d6c239aba22e1925e0339e8afeb5
spent
true